- [ ] Queue-depth autoscaler (Pellmere pipeline): verify scale-up triggers at the agreed depth threshold and scale-down respects the five-minute cooldown. Run the synthetic backlog test in staging and confirm worker count returns to baseline afterward. Check that the autoscaler's metrics land in the shared dashboard so the sync has visibility next week. Before marking this done, confirm the deployed artifact matches the approved build noted below.

trace token, fafog-kageg: htk4_98e6

## Runbook: Read-replica lag alarm (Kestrel DB)

When the Kestrel replica-lag alarm fires, first confirm it isn't a scheduled batch job — the Orley reporting export runs nightly and routinely spikes lag for ten minutes. If lag persists past twenty minutes, check replication slot status and disk pressure on the replica host. Never restart the primary; that's an escalation. Before making any changes, compare the live replication settings against the known-good baseline, which is the following.

settings of tagef-bawif:
DRUIX_HOST=druix.zemvarlabs.internal
DRUIX_PORT=8000

Dependency pinning at Bramblehook is strict: every service pins exact versions in its lockfile, and upgrades flow only through the weekly Renovault batch. On-call engineers must never hand-edit pins during an incident without a rollback note. If you need the emergency override config, unlock the policy vault with the passphrase below.

unlock words, fawif-hahip: eliax-ulador-holdor-novix-prawyn-norius-kelax-weniel-alddor-ulaion